"Walkin' Down Vine Street" (Etude #12) is a Blues in G to be played with a medium swing feel.  Following a 5-measure introduction, there are six choruses of 12-bar Blues, followed by a 5-measure coda.  The left hand includes a "walking" bass line throughout the six Blues choruses, while the melodic line in the right hand is in the style of improvisations by hard-bop jazz pianists Wynton Kelly, Sonny Clark, and others from the early 1960s.  Careful attention should be paid to the phrase markings and articulations.
